Description

NatureScot, in collaboration with Liverpool John Moores University, is looking for a supplier to work with our in-house teams to support the creation of a geospatial web application within the Amazon Web Services (AWS) Environment that will enable a natural capital approach at landscape scale. In particular, the geospatial web application should be suitable for use by non-technical audiences, with a polished user interface and collaboration functionality. The tool should have secure AWS cloud-hosted log-ins, as well as the functionality to update the tool's source data both frequently and automatically. The development of this web application will be split into three distinct phases. The first phase, which is the focus of this ITT, is the development of an options appraisal for how to build the application. Full details are within the Statement of Requirements attached to this Contract Notice.
